This medicine contains the active ingredients: 5mg of chlorhexidine dihydrochloride, 4mg of benzocaine and 3mg of enoxolone. Chlorhexidine has antibactetial effect (it destroys bacteria), and it is used as antiseptic. Benzocaine serves as an anesthetic, and enoxolone is known for its anti-inflammatory properties. This medicine is intended for local and temporary symptomatic relief of moderate infectious and inflammatory conditions of the mouth and throat, and sore throat without fever, caused by external factors such as smog, sudden changes in temperature and dust.
